bin/background_jobs 0 → 100755
@@ -0,0 +1,80 @@ @@ -0,0 +1,80 @@
  1 +#!/usr/bin/env bash
  2 +
  3 +cd $(dirname $0)/..
  4 +app_root=$(pwd)
  5 +sidekiq_pidfile="$app_root/tmp/pids/sidekiq.pid"
  6 +sidekiq_logfile="$app_root/log/sidekiq.log"
  7 +gitlab_user=$(ls -l config.ru | awk '{print $3}')
  8 +
  9 +function warn
  10 +{
  11 + echo "$@" 1>&2
  12 +}
  13 +
  14 +function stop
  15 +{
  16 + bundle exec sidekiqctl stop $sidekiq_pidfile >> $sidekiq_logfile 2>&1
  17 +}
  18 +
  19 +function killall
  20 +{
  21 + pkill -u $gitlab_user -f sidekiq
  22 +}
  23 +
  24 +function restart
  25 +{
  26 + if [ -f $sidekiq_pidfile ]; then
  27 + stop
  28 + fi
  29 + killall
  30 + start_sidekiq -d -L $sidekiq_logfile
  31 +}
  32 +
  33 +function start_no_deamonize
  34 +{
  35 + start_sidekiq
  36 +}
  37 +
  38 +function start_sidekiq
  39 +{
  40 + bundle exec sidekiq -q post_receive -q mailer -q system_hook -q project_web_hook -q gitlab_shell -q common -q default -e $RAILS_ENV -P $sidekiq_pidfile $@ >> $sidekiq_logfile 2>&1
  41 +}
  42 +
  43 +function load_ok
  44 +{
  45 + sidekiq_pid=$(cat $sidekiq_pidfile)
  46 + if [[ -z $sidekiq_pid ]] ; then
  47 + warn "Could not find a PID in $sidekiq_pidfile"
  48 + exit 0
  49 + fi
  50 +
  51 + if (ps -p $sidekiq_pid -o args | grep '\([0-9]\+\) of \1 busy' 1>&2) ; then
  52 + warn "Too many busy Sidekiq workers"
  53 + exit 1
  54 + fi
  55 +
  56 + exit 0
  57 +}
  58 +
  59 +case "$1" in
  60 + stop)
  61 + stop
  62 + ;;
  63 + start)
  64 + restart
  65 + ;;
  66 + start_no_deamonize)
  67 + start_no_deamonize
  68 + ;;
  69 + restart)
  70 + restart
  71 + ;;
  72 + killall)
  73 + killall
  74 + ;;
  75 + load_ok)
  76 + load_ok
  77 + ;;
  78 + *)
  79 + echo "Usage: RAILS_ENV=your_env $0 {stop|start|start_no_deamonize|restart|killall|load_ok}"
  80 +esac

bin/web 0 → 100755
@@ -0,0 +1,49 @@ @@ -0,0 +1,49 @@
  1 +#!/usr/bin/env bash
  2 +
  3 +cd $(dirname $0)/..
  4 +app_root=$(pwd)
  5 +
  6 +unicorn_pidfile="$app_root/tmp/pids/unicorn.pid"
  7 +unicorn_config="$app_root/config/unicorn.rb"
  8 +
  9 +function get_unicorn_pid
  10 +{
  11 + local pid=$(cat $unicorn_pidfile)
  12 + if [ -z $pid ] ; then
  13 + echo "Could not find a PID in $unicorn_pidfile"
  14 + exit 1
  15 + fi
  16 + unicorn_pid=$pid
  17 +}
  18 +
  19 +function start
  20 +{
  21 + bundle exec unicorn_rails -D -c $unicorn_config -E $RAILS_ENV
  22 +}
  23 +
  24 +function stop
  25 +{
  26 + get_unicorn_pid
  27 + kill -QUIT $unicorn_pid
  28 +}
  29 +
  30 +function reload
  31 +{
  32 + get_unicorn_pid
  33 + kill -USR2 $unicorn_pid
  34 +}
  35 +
  36 +case "$1" in
  37 + start)
  38 + start
  39 + ;;
  40 + stop)
  41 + stop
  42 + ;;
  43 + reload)
  44 + reload
  45 + ;;
  46 + *)
  47 + echo "Usage: RAILS_ENV=your_env $0 {start|stop|reload}"
  48 + ;;
  49 +esac
